Nuclear Envoys of S. Korea, US to Hold Talks over N. Korea's Nuke Test
2016-09-12 Updated.
 
The top nuclear envoys of South Korea and the United States will hold talks in Seoul on Monday and Tuesday to discuss countermeasures, including fresh sanctions against North Korea over its latest nuclear test.

Sung Kim, the U.S. chief delegate to the six-party nuclear talks, will arrive in South Korea on Monday afternoon after he held talks with his Japanese counterpart Kenji Kanasugi in Tokyo on Sunday.

Kim is scheduled to have dinner with Seoul's Special Representative for Korean Peninsula Peace and Security Affairs Kim Hong-kyun on Monday and hold talks on Tuesday morning before opening a joint news conference.

A South Korean government official said that the talks will naturally focus on the North’s fifth nuclear test and the slapping of more sanctions by the UN Security Council as well as by Seoul and Washington.
